Healthy Cabbage Rolls with Tofu
Cabbage rolls are a traditional dish in many cuisines around the world, including Eastern European, Middle Eastern, and Asian cuisines. They are often enjoyed during holidays and special occasions.
This is vegan, gluten free and high protein recipe. Dish can be prepared in 80 minutes. Recipe requires some culinary experience (medium difficulty). Number of ingredients: 11.

Instructions
-
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
-
Bring a large pot of water to a boil.
-
Carefully remove the outer leaves of the cabbage head and blanch them in the boiling water for 2-3 minutes until softened. Remove and set aside.
-
In a skillet, he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il over medium heat. Add the diced onion, grated carrots, and minced garlic. Sauté until the vegetables are tender.
-
In a separate pan, cook the brown rice according to package instructions.
-
In a bowl, crumble the tofu and mix it with the cooked brown rice, sautéed vegetables, tomato sauce, salt, and pepper.
-
Place a spoonful of the tofu and rice mixture onto each cabbage leaf. Roll the leaf tightly, tucking in the sides as you go.
-
Place the cabbage rolls in a baking dish and pour vegetable broth over them.
-
Cover the dish with foil and bake for 30 minutes.
-
Remove the foil and bake for an additional 10 minutes until the cabbage rolls are golden brown.
-
Let the cabbage rolls rest for 10 minutes before serving.
